## Authentication

Quick note before you poke at this: sqlint-forge, our linter for SQL files, doesn't just run locally — it pulls the shared rule catalog (naming conventions, forbidden hints, the whole list) from our internal rules service on every run. That fetch is authenticated, mostly so nobody can quietly swap a rule set mid-review. Tokens are short-scoped and read-only, so the blast radius is small, but treat them like any other credential. For local runs, the tool reads the key shown below.

service key, fawip-bajef: kto11_Qt5wZK9vdNC

Action item: The Relayn deploy-status bot silently dropped updates when the pipeline API paginated results, so responders believed a rollback had completed when it had not. We will add pagination handling, a staleness banner, and an integration test. Until merged, verify deploy state directly in the pipeline console, documented at the page below.

runbook for kahop-kajop: https://rundeck.ordinio.test/display/secrets/pipeline/issue/pages/repo/browse/e5732776e07d1285107e5aeb

Hi — quick quarterly note as you step into the director role at Marlowe & Finch Analytics. Heads up: we've frozen hiring across the Data Tools division until the Kestrel platform migration wraps, probably mid-next-quarter. Backfills need VP sign-off; contractors are fine for now. Morale's okay, but Dara's team is stretched, so keep an eye there. The confidential bit on our plans sits just below.

board note of kageg-bahof: The renewal with Holwynax Holdings closes at $2 million a year, 5 percent below the last contract. Project Ulaath slips by two quarters because of the supplier delay.